Olympia Financial Earnings Drop as Lower Interest Income Offsets Growth in Service Fees

Meet Samuel – Your Personal Investing Prophet

Olympia Financial ( (TSE:OLY) ) has provided an announcement.

Olympia Financial Group Inc. reported that for the year ended December 31, 2025, net earnings fell 17% to $19.86 million, with basic and diluted earnings per share dropping to $8.25 from $9.94. Total revenue declined 4% to $98.86 million, largely due to lower trust, interest, and other income tied to decreased interest rates on trust fund placements over the past year.

Service revenue rose 5% to $50 million on higher monthly and transaction fees driven by account growth in the IAS division, partially offsetting weaker trust income. Total expenses inched up 1% to $72.51 million, reflecting investments in advanced AI-driven computer system upgrades and business process automation, as well as higher legal costs, suggesting Olympia is spending to modernize operations even as earnings come under pressure from the interest rate environment.

More about Olympia Financial

Olympia Financial Group Inc., listed on the TSX under the symbol OLY, operates primarily through Olympia Trust Company, a non-deposit-taking trust company licensed across multiple Canadian provinces. The group administers self-directed registered plan accounts, corporate trust and transfer agency services, while also offering currency exchange, global payments, private health services plans, and IT services to exempt market dealers, registrants, and issuers through its various subsidiaries.
